vue要实现SEO,必须得让页面全部静态化而要静态化,通常是在服务端进行渲染可以参考网页链接 但是个人建议,如果你的技术不是特别棒,不要去尝试使用vue这个新出来的技术,老老实实的用php等成熟的技术。
vue等框架打包的项目一般为SPA应用,而单页面是不利于SEO的,现在的解决方案有两种注意然后在里面添加在的plugins里面添加最后在mainjs里面修改安装在mainjs引入在vue页面中配置。
Vue Admin Plus 是一个企业级中后台管理系统解决方案,它完美融合了 Vite5 和 Vue3 的优势,为开发者提供了一个高效全面且易用的后台管理框架以下是对 Vue Admin Plus 的详细介绍一框架基础 Vite5Vite 是一个新型的前端构建工具,它提供了极快的冷启动即时热模块更新HMR丰富的。
开发一个基于Vue的网站时需要注意的SEO问题有静态标题和描述标题和描述必须是静态的,不能在运行时动态生成,因为搜索引擎需要读取它们避免使用JavaScript动态生成内容搜索引擎不会读取JavaScript动态生成的内容,因此,如果你想在搜索结果中显示这些内容,你需要使用静态的HTML关键字优化确保你的关键。
一引入Nuxt框架Nuxt 是基于Vue开发的一套前端框架,它简化了Vue项目的服务端渲染SSR配置,非常适合用于SEO优化安装Nuxt安装Nuxt框架的过程与Vue类似,可以参考Nuxt的官方文档进行安装迁移项目将原Vue项目中的页面文件位于viewscomponents文件夹和静态资源assets文件夹迁移到Nuxt项目的相。
首先,服务器端渲染SSR对于Vuejs来说至关重要由于Vuejs主要采用客户端渲染CSR,搜索引擎爬虫在抓取网页内容时可能无法获取到完整的页面内容,因此,采用SSR可以将页面内容预先渲染并发送给搜索引擎,从而提高SEO效果单页面应用SPA的局限性也不容忽视Vuejs常用于构建SPA,在用户交互过程中。
在2023年末,我决定改造我的UtilMeta项目官网,原因在于之前的官网采用Vue2实现的SPA应用,对搜索引擎SEO不友好,这对于项目介绍官网来说是一个严重问题因此,我选择了ViteSSG + Vue3 + Vuetify3来重新构建官网,耗时约两周文章将记录开发过程中的思考和总结,重点涉及SEO优化的重要性及合适的开发。
转载请注明来自中国金属学会,本文标题:《如何在Vue.js中实现动态SEO_Vue.js动态SEO对于企业级应用有什么特殊要求》
还没有评论,来说两句吧...